Below is a list of the five biggest biotech stocks by market capitalization.

The biotech stock with the fifth-largest market cap is Regeneron Pharmaceuticals Inc (NASDAQ: REGN).

View gallery.At time of writing, Regeneron’s market cap sat just over $41 billion.The fourth-largest biotech stock is Biogen Idec Inc (NASDAQ: BIIB).View gallery.Biogen’s market cap is more than double that of Regeneron at above $83 billion.Coming in as the third-biggest biotech stock on the block is Celgene Corporation (NASDAQ: CELG).View gallery.Celgene has a market capitalization of $98 billion.The second-largest biotech stock by market cap is Amgen, Inc. (NASDAQ: AMGN).View gallery.With a market cap of $120 billion, Amgen is still a distance from the largest biotech of them all.The biggest biotech is Gilead Sciences, Inc. (NASDAQ: GILD).View gallery.Gilead is bigger than both Biogen and Regeneron put together with a market cap of over $155 billion.All five stocks closed up in the green on Tuesday.See more from BenzingaBig Short Interest On These 5 Biotech Stocks
